> Hardly. I'm not one to wave statistics about as if they told the whole
> truth, but this is one of the things I tend to keep an eye on during the
> last day's bouts. My own ballpark figure would be about two to one in favor
> of the man with seven and needing the eighth.  Ands don't forget that many
> of the final day's 7-7 bouts are 7-7 doshi - that is, both parties have 7-7,
> so there's a real crunch there!

But even in those situations, not everything is equal.  Suppose an M15
ends up fighting an M11.  Obviously, one of those rikishi can "afford" the
makekoshi, while the other one kind (I'll leave it as an exercise to the
reader to determine which is which)
